Output e4cc76ea9a5db6fbd792abb59bf14a8eb6b46c503d076c820706bbcd0cf55deb:0

value
35409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 961bb988414c68168ec7acc7114e72621753eca5 OP_EQUAL
address
3FNiVfd2fPsRbLPSztFtQT59nMaCzM2xf5
transaction
e4cc76ea9a5db6fbd792abb59bf14a8eb6b46c503d076c820706bbcd0cf55deb
confirmations
70544
spent
true